The Position
The Print Media Analyst will support the account team with analysis and performance tracking for the advancement of client business. The ideal candidate is a critical thinker with a keen interest in
understanding data and identifying trends, provides insight, and has powerful analytic skills and excellent communication skills for client-facing presentations. The successful candidate will be an experienced print media analyst with minimum 7 years’ experience who is looking to be a key contributor and exercise their passion for numbers and data in a fun, strategic and fast paced environment.

Responsibilities
• Interpret sales and marketing data for a national telecommunications client in newspaper channel
• Oversee the tracking and reporting of client data on a daily, weekly, monthly basis to assess campaign performance
• Provide analytic insight and recommendations to improve “next time” performance
• Manage and optimize client media plan; provide sales forecasting based on analyzed trends and media opportunities
• Partner with the analytics and program management teams to build the framework for analytics ‘story’ and develop clear, easy to follow conclusions
• Develop predictive models, response curves, and test matrices
• Provide statistical guidance on test initiatives
• Build client presentations and data analysis summaries
• Maintain accuracy in all reporting, analysis, and communications
• Work with technology team to develop appropriate measurement, analysis, and reporting tools to support business objectives and improve time efficiencies
